Handle more cases in LiveRangeEdit::eliminateDeadDefs.
Live intervals for dead physregs may be created during coalescing. We need to update these in the event that their instruction goes away. crash.ll is the unit test that catches it when MI sched is enabled on X86. llvm-svn: 184572
